Life insurance may be continued at the employee's expense, at the University's group rates, until the employee returns to active payroll, or until his/her employment at WMU is terminated.
If the employee wishes to maintain the policy after termination, the employee may elect to convert his/her group life insurance to individual policies through the University's life insurance carrier (see following provision).

If an event occurs that makes an employee eligible to convert his/her group life insurance to individual policies, the employee should contact Human Resources to obtain the appropriate forms and instructions. Employees have thirty-one (31) days from the date of the event to submit the appropriate forms and initial premium.
